#452c88 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#452c88 is composed of 27.1% red, 17.3%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 67.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 256.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 35.3%. #452c88 color hex could be obtained by blending #8a58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#452c88 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#452c88 has RGB values of R:69, G:44,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 4533384.

Shades and Tints of #452c88
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f5f3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#452c88
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#58565e is the less saturated color, while #3202b2 is the most saturated one.
